This copyright record (Registration Number: SR0000629013) was filed with the U.S. Copyright Office on 1 Apr 2009. The work is titled "Nine Songs from One is Too Many (A Thousand is Never Enough)" and was created in 2009. Jeff Bourne holds the copyright for this sound recording and music registration work.
